My wife just ordered a replacement battery for her rezound. At first glance it appears identical, but wouldn't seat in the battery compartment. I checked and noticed the tabs in the bottom corner are slightly different shapes.

Upon further inspection, I see that the battery voltage is 3.7 rather than 3.8, and the part number of the battery is off by one digit. However, both batteries say "Phone Model: ADR6425", which matches the rezound.

Anyone know what gives here?

Would it be safe to simply file the notch slightly to make it fit since it seems otherwise to be the same battery?

Any help is appreciated

Early Rezounds had a 3.8v battery, later models shipped with a 3.7v, this is not uncommon. That being said, batteries are a finicky thing, especially on an older device where OEM ones are tough to come by,,, If it doesn't fit then it obviously is not the correct one, regardless of what it says on the packaging. You might be able to trim it up and get it to fit and it might work, but I guess that depends on your prerogative here...
